What are open hem tracksuit bottoms?
- Open hem tracksuit bottoms are a type of jogger or pant that features an open hem at the ankle, allowing for a relaxed fit. This design provides ease of movement and a casual look, making them ideal for both exercise and everyday wear. They are typically made from comfortable, stretchy materials.

What materials are commonly used for open hem tracksuit bottoms?
- Open hem tracksuit bottoms are typically made from a variety of materials, including cotton, polyester, and blends that offer stretch and breathability. Some styles may feature fleece lining for added warmth, while others use lightweight fabrics for a cooler feel. Always check the fabric composition for comfort and suitability.
